Skip to content

Commit

Permalink
Version 1.4
Browse files Browse the repository at this point in the history
  • Loading branch information
rasa committed Feb 18, 2015
1 parent a31ec14 commit 684053a
Show file tree
Hide file tree
Showing 4 changed files with 41 additions and 12 deletions.
39 changes: 31 additions & 8 deletions attr.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-351,6 +351,11 @@ int main(int argc, char **argv) {
break;

switch (c) {
/*
"-n | --not-indexed + | - Set/reset content not indexed bit\n"
"-o | --offline + | - Set/reset offline bit\n"
"-t | --temporary + | - Set/reset temporary bit\n"
*/
case 'a':
if (!set_flag(&opt.archive, optarg)) {
usage();
Expand All @@ -363,11 +368,23 @@ int main(int argc, char **argv) {
case 'e':
opt.abort = true;
break;
case 'h':
if (!set_flag(&opt.hidden, optarg)) {
usage();
exit(1);
}
break;
case 'i':
opt.hide = true;
break;
case 'h':
if (!set_flag(&opt.hidden, optarg)) {
case 'n':
if (!set_flag(&opt.not_indexed, optarg)) {
usage();
exit(1);
}
break;
case 'o':
if (!set_flag(&opt.offline, optarg)) {
usage();
exit(1);
}
Expand All @@ -384,24 +401,30 @@ int main(int argc, char **argv) {
exit(1);
}
break;
case 't':
if (!set_flag(&opt.temporary, optarg)) {
usage();
exit(1);
}
break;
case 'q':
if (opt.verbose > 0)
--opt.verbose;
break;
case 'v':
++opt.verbose;
break;
case 'y':
opt.dry_run = true;
break;
case 'R':
opt.recursive = true;
break;
case 'v':
++opt.verbose;
break;
case 'V':
cout <<
APPNAME " " APPVERSION " - " __DATE__ << endl <<
APPCOPYRIGHT << endl;
break;
case 'y':
opt.dry_run = true;
break;
case '?':
usage();
break;
Expand Down
6 changes: 6 additions & 0 deletions changelog.txt
Original file line number Diff line number Diff line change
@@ -1,5 +1,11 @@
attr changelog

Version 1.4 - 28 Feb 07:

Enabled -n | --not-indexed + | - Set/reset content not indexed bit
Enabled -o | --offline + | - Set/reset offline bit
Enabled -t | --temporary + | - Set/reset temporary bit

Version 1.3 - 14 Nov 06:

Added display of attributes in the form 'arhsnot'
Expand Down
4 changes: 2 additions & 2 deletions readme.txt
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
attr - Version 1.3 - Nov 24 2006
Copyright (c) 2004-2006 Ross Smith II (http://smithii.com) All Rights Reserved
attr - Version 1.4 - Feb 28 2007
Copyright (c) 2004-2007 Ross Smith II (http://smithii.com) All Rights Reserved

------------------------------------------------------------------------------

Expand Down
4 changes: 2 additions & 2 deletions version.h
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 General Public License for more details.
#define VER_INTERNAL_NAME "attr"
#define VER_FILE_DESCRIPTION "Set File Attributes"
#define VER_MAJOR 1
#define VER_MINOR 3
#define VER_STRING2 "1.3"
#define VER_MINOR 4
#define VER_STRING2 "1.4"

#include "ver_defaults.h"

0 comments on commit 684053a

Please sign in to comment.